Senate Study Bill 1187 - Introduced SENATE RESOLUTION NO. _____ BY (PROPOSED COMMITTEE ON STATE GOVERNMENT RESOLUTION BY CHAIRPERSON DANIELSON) A Resolution establishing the support of the Iowa 1 Senate, on behalf of the people of Iowa, of an 2 amendment to the United States Constitution 3 restricting corporate participation and 4 contributions in election campaigns. 5 WHEREAS, the United States Constitution and the 6 Bill of Rights are intended to protect the rights 7 of “natural persons”, that is, individual human 8 beings; and 9 WHEREAS, corporations are not mentioned in the 10 United States Constitution, and the people have never 11 granted full Constitutional rights to corporations as 12 natural persons, let alone the First Amendment rights 13 of natural persons; and 14 WHEREAS, the United States Supreme Court held 15 in Buckley v. Valeo (1976) that the appearance of 16 corruption justified certain limits on contributions to 17 candidates; and 18 WHEREAS, the United States Supreme Court recognized 19 in Austin v. Michigan Chamber of Commerce (1990) 20 the threat to a republican form of government posed 21 by the corrosive and distorting effects of immense 22 aggregations of wealth that are accumulated with 23 the help of the corporate form and that have little 24 or no correlation to the public’s support for the 25 corporation’s political ideas; and 26 WHEREAS, the United States Supreme Court in Citizens 27 -1- LSB 1699XC (5) 85 jr/sc 1/ 2
S.R. _____ United v. the Federal Election Commission (2010) 1 reversed the decision in Austin, thereby presenting 2 a threat to self-government by eliminating legal 3 limits on corporate spending in the electoral process, 4 thus allowing unlimited corporate spending to 5 influence candidate selection, elections, and policy 6 decisions; and 7 WHEREAS, Article V of the United States Constitution 8 empowers and obligates the people of the United States 9 of America to use the amendment process in Article V 10 of the United States Constitution to correct those 11 egregious decisions of the United States Supreme 12 Court that go to the heart of our democracy and the 13 republican form of self-government; NOW THEREFORE, 14 BE IT RESOLVED BY THE SENATE, That the Iowa 15 Senate, acting on behalf of the people of Iowa, 16 supports efforts to propose and ratify an amendment 17 to the United States Constitution restricting 18 corporate participation and contributions in 19 election campaigns and, to that end, respectfully 20 urges Iowa’s congressional delegation to prioritize 21 congressional proposal of an amendment to the United 22 States Constitution to restrict participation 23 and contributions by corporations in election 24 campaigns; and 25 B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, That a copy of this 26 resolution be provided to each member of Iowa’s 27 congressional delegation. 28 -2- LSB 1699XC (5) 85 jr/sc 2/ 2
